“Agentic browsers” are web browsers or AI systems that can perform tasks on their own, without needing constant input from the user. For example, they can search for information, complete tasks, and make decisions by themselves.

The idea of agentic browsers became more popular in 2023 when advanced AI systems like ChatGPT started interacting with the internet. These systems could gather information and do things without users having to tell them exactly what to do every time.

However, while this is convenient, it can also be risky. If these systems are given too much control, they could make wrong decisions or do harmful things. This has raised concerns about their safety and security.
